Harriet's splash of colour in Brum's Golden Mile

Harriet Crellin with her winning picture.

HUNDREDS of youngsters put their artistic skills to the test to enter Broad Street's Christmas colouring competition.

The contest was staged by the Broad Street Business Improvement District to encourage family visitors to the area in the lead-up to the hugely popular Canal Boat Light Parade.

The overall winner was six-year-old Harriet Crellin, from Feckenham, Worcestershire.

Steve Hewlett, of the BID, said: "We had a great response from visitors across the Midlands, even from as far as Bristol and Wales.

"The businesses have commented that they've had lots of enthusiastic young artists working on the picture of Santa on his canal boat."

Harriet and her family are now looking forward to enjoying her prize - a weekend enjoying Broad Street's attractions, including visits to Cineworld, the National Sea Life Centre, T Mobile Street Ice, and a performance of The Snowman at the Rep.

They will stay in a Livingbase apartment in Brindleyplace.
